When your baby chick enters its second week, you need to start lowering the temperature. Make sure that you drop down the brooder temperature by 5 degrees, bringing it to 85 degrees F. The best way to accomplish this is to raise the brooder lamp by a few inches. During this time period, it is still essential to give your baby chick ...

Between 2-4 weeks, most chicks have started to develop their adult feathers and will look a bit disheveled. The feather-growing process may last up to 5-6 weeks, depending on the breed and diet. Feb 8, 2015.1. Check immediately. Vent sexing must be done within the first day or two after a chick hatches. As the chick eats and grows, its lower digestive tract will distend, blocking the rudimentary sex organ from view. Comfortable human homes are 20 to 30 degrees Fahrenheit too cold for baby chickens. The ideal temperature for chicks, seven days old or younger, is 95 degrees F. Week two is 90, week three is 85. Each week declines by five degrees until chicks are ready to live outside. Why can mother hens bring babies outside, even in freezing weather?

The one with the lighter beak is called White Tip. hibachi cameron nc The ideal time to determine the sex of Polish chicks is when they are 1-2 weeks old. Even at an early age, the crest of a Polish chick is different between sexes. A Polish female chick has a rounded, puffy crest with a distinct circular shape.
